Abstract [eng] Modern tractors, cars, and other self-propelled machines – are complex mobile machines for agriculture, transport and other tasks. Cars adapt to drag trailers and semi-trailers are called tractors. Tractor or truck with one or more trailers is train car. Chassis is transport, to which the trailer sits all sets. Chassis wheel rotation change to the car's rolling motion, mitigate impacts resulting from driving on uneven road surfaces, suppresses body roll. Trailer chassis consists of the frame, axles, suspension and wheels. Work purpose – trailer chassis for individual structural elements of strength study. In work, to achieve the targets, the following tasks are solved: an overview of the different chassis design; analyzes tested trailer chassis design; with program “SolidWorks” plotted tested chassis model; conducted individual nodes analytic calculation of the strength; with program “SolidWorks” model of strength analysis is performed; analyzed and compared the obtained results. In this work was analyzed investigated trailer chassis design and found the weakest link in its place. It is the neck of the lever axis. The neck of the axis has been studied in two ways: analytical calculation and with program “SolidWorks”. The results showed that an increase in dimension of the neck of the axis just 1,4 %, can increases load to 12 %.
